In May this year 2025, I took off on a wild loop across the Western USA — through Colorado, Utah, Arizona, and New Mexico — with my sketchbook, paints, and camera in hand.
At nearly every stop, I tried to pause and create something on the spot. Sometimes it was a quick sketch next to the van. Sometimes it was a full painting session on a hiking trail. And sometimes it was just a photo I knew I’d turn into art later.
This series of works is a little love letter to the road — to the cowboys in Utah, the snowy peaks in Colorado, the blooming cactus in Arizona, and the incredible creatives I met along the way. Each piece is tied to a real moment — not just what I saw, but how it felt to stand in it.
I've shared the artworks below — a collection of scenes that now live not only in my memory, but on canvas.
